Responsibilities

Overview: Support daily production with process or quality issues, providing quick response and presence on the shop floor

Responsibilities:

  • Follow and comply with all OSHA and company safety procedures.
  • Monitor, support and improve production yield rates in accordance with company targets.
  • Audit, maintain and improve existing processes, identifying issues and proposing corrective actions with respective implementation, while expressing a good problem solving capability.
  • Develop and qualify new products and processes, manage projects with proper documentation and consistent monitoring while following IDEMIA routine and “IWay” standards.
  • Define and measure manufacturing capabilities and capacities of all processes under engineering control to provide data to planning and scheduling teams.
  • Assist in designing industrialization plans for new products, processes or equipment following the industrial qualification procedure in relation to Company Quality Assurance standards
  • Monitor the industrialization of CNC engraving and singulation processes, support production on CNC equipment
  • Investigate customer complaints with Quality Assurance, Production and Customer Services and make containment and improvement recommendations with a continuous improvement approach
  • Lead small projects and small teams to perform a process improvement or problem solving activity, or to complete successfully a qualification
  • Present the status of his activities and project to the management via regular written reports or oral presentations
Qualifications
  • Bachelor degree (B. S.) from a four-year college or university with emphasis in Mechanical, industrial or chemical Engineering.
  • Possess solid understanding of engineering principles including developing, qualifying and implementing new production processes within a manufacturing environment.
  • 1-2 years of experience with CNC programming and manufacturing
  • Knowledge of G-Code programming
  • Excellent time management, communications, presentation and organization skills.
  • Experience with new products development, qualification and introduction.
  • Strong experience in root cause analysis, problem solving using different methodologies (8D, 6 Sigma, QRQC…).
  • Proficient in Microsoft applications to include Excel and Pivot tables.
